Job Description

Essential Duties of this Opportunity: The Interim Branch Manager serves as the temporary Local Leader for the branch during a leadership transition. In this role, you will provide stability, continuity, and direction for the branch team while maintaining alignment with Barnhart's Mission Statement and Core Values. You will partner closely with Regional and Senior Leadership to ensure operational excellence, customer satisfaction, employee engagement, and financial performance are sustained throughout the interim assignment.

As the Interim Local Leader, you will be entrusted to guide branch operations, support team development, and maintain Barnhart's high standards of safety, quality, and execution until permanent leadership is established.

  • Lead with alignment to Barnhart's Mission Statement and Core Values. Barnhart has chosen Servant Leadership as the model to reflect the leadership of the "One Team."
  • Provide leadership continuity during a branch transition by maintaining operational effectiveness, team engagement, customer relationships, and financial performance.
  • Motivate and support the Branch Team in achieving Barnhart's success metrics related to Financial Returns, Safety, Customer Satisfaction, and other key performance indicators.
  • Partner with Regional and Senior Leadership to identify priorities, address challenges, and implement operational improvements as needed.
  • Maintain accountability across Sales, Operations, Project Management, Dispatch, Maintenance, and Facilities functions to ensure branch performance remains strong.
  • Foster a culture of Significance, Belonging, Trust, Progress, and Recognition through coaching, communication, and leadership presence.
  • Collaborate with other branches to support regional and national project execution while ensuring local operational needs are met.
  • Champion Barnhart's commitment to safety, quality, and customer service, ensuring branch activities comply with company standards and expectations.
  • Evaluate branch performance, identify opportunities for improvement, and provide recommendations to support long-term branch success.

Preferred Experience

  • Demonstrated leadership experience developing teams and strengthening cultures aligned with company mission, values, and performance expectations.
  • Ability to quickly assess business operations, identify priorities, and effectively lead teams through periods of transition or change.
  • Mechanically inclined with a proven track record of success in rigging, lifting, fabrication, maintenance, transportation, or related operations.
  • Financial acumen with experience managing budgets, business plans, performance metrics, and operational results.
  • Project management experience within construction, industrial, heavy lift, transportation, or related industries.
  • Strong communication, computer software, and reporting skills with the ability to analyze and communicate operational and financial performance metrics.

Education: Bachelor's degree or equivalent combination of education and experience.

Experience: Previous leadership or management experience required. Experience leading teams through organizational change, business transitions, or turnaround situations is preferred.

PURPOSE – Barnhart is built on a strong foundation of serving others. The fruit of our labor is used to grow the company, care for our employees, and serve those in our communities and around the world.

MINDS OVER MATTER – Barnhart has built a nationwide reputation for solving problems. We specialize in the lifting, heavy-rigging, and heavy transport of major components used in American industry.

NETWORK – Barnhart has built teams that form one of our industry's strongest networks of talent and resources with over 60 branch locations across the U.S. working together to serve our customers. This growing network offers our team members constant opportunity for career growth and professional development.
